Inside Out Right Angle Weave Earring - DIY Jewelry Making Tutorial by PotomacBeads

Learn to craft stunning Inside Out Right Angle Weave Earrings with this DIY jewelry-making tutorial. Master the right angle weave technique using Miyuki seed beads in Opaque Turquoise Green and Duracoat Galvanized Gold, alongside shimmering Potomac Crystal Bicone Beads. Add a touch of elegance with Athenacast metal charms and earwires, all detailed in easy-to-follow steps. Perfect for both beginner and experienced beaders!
